The correct order in Georgia
Follow this sequence in Georgia:
- 1. Certified marriage certificate: order copies from the Georgia Department of Public Health, State Office of Vital Records.
- 2. Social Security (SS-5): free, and always first.
- 3. Wait 24–48 hours for the SSA record to sync.
- 4. Georgia Department of Driver Services (DDS): update your license (about $32 (confirm with the agency)).
- 5. Passport: DS-82, DS-11, or DS-5504.
- 6. Voter registration & everyone else: bank, employer, insurers.

Georgia documents to gather
- Certified marriage certificate (name-change document)
- Current Georgia driver's license or ID card
- Updated Social Security card showing new name (update SSA first, then wait 24-48 hours before visiting DDS)
- Two proofs of Georgia residency (for REAL ID compliance)
- For hyphenated surnames: certified copy of the marriage license application showing the hyphenated name selection
Good to know for Georgia: Statewide marriage records covered are from June 9, 1952 to present. Process is primarily mail-in (complete and mail the Request for Search of Marriage form or Marriage Verification Request form); $10 search fee plus $5 per additional copy. For marriages before June 1952 or for faster/in-person same-day service, contact the Probate Court in the county where the marriage license was issued.
What a name change costs in Georgia
- Certified marriage certificate (3 copies): $30–$90
- Social Security card (Form SS-5): Free
- Driver's license update (Georgia Department of Driver Services (DDS)): about $32 (confirm with the agency)
- Passport (only if you update it): Free–$165
- Voter registration: Free
Most people spend roughly $62–$287 in Georgia: on the low end if you skip the passport, on the high end with a full passport renewal and extra certificate copies.
